Clara Foldes' certificate for a defense course

This is a certificate issued to me in Alba Iulia in 1940 for a defence course. I started a two months defense course as a volunteer in 1938. I spent the first month in Turda. We had both theory and practical classes. I learned to use a shotgun. There was an officer who trained us. His name was Pitic and he was very accursed. I couldn't finish this course because after the first part Jews weren't allowed anymore, so I was sent home. I cried all the way back home from Turda. I finished the first part in 1939, by the time I had already been accepted in Alba Iulia as a teacher at the Jewish elementary school.
